Hi Diane,
You need to add your blog's RSS feed to FeedBurner, when you create your feed in FeedBurner it should ask you for this information.
FYI, Feedburner is system that enables users to sign up to your blog and be notified when new posts are made, it is not a platform for blogging.
Here is a blog post I wrote a while back explaining how to use FeedBurner with Wordpress, but it's applicable to any website with an RSS / Atom feed http://techspotting.org/how-to-use-feedburner-with-wordpress/
It's a nice step by step post with screen shots
